Biography

Dr. Jie Shen

Departmentof Coamputer & Information Science

University of Michigan - Dearborn, USA

Associate Professor


Email: shen@umich.edu


Qulifications

2000 Ph.D. in Computer Science, University of Saskatchewan (Canada)

1997 M.Sc. in Computer Science, University of Saskatchewan (Canada)

1988 Ph.D. in Vehicle Engineering, Beijing University of A.E. (China)

1985 M.Sc. in Vehicle Engineering, Jiangsu Science Tech Univ. (China)

1982 B.Sc. in Vehicle Engineering, Jiangsu Science Tech Univ. (China)
